Ingredients
To make these delicious Dubai Chocolate Ice Cream Bars, you will need the following ingredients:
- 13.5 can of coconut cream (solid parts only)
- 1/2 cup coconut milk
- 1/2 cup pistachio cream
- 1 tsp vanilla extract
- 1/4 cup coconut sugar
- 1 cup kataifi
- 2 tsp oil
- 1/4 cup pistachio cream
- 1 cup chocolate (melted)
- 3 tsp coconut oil
- chopped pistachios (for garnish)
How to Make Dubai Chocolate Ice Cream Bars
Step 1: Blend the Base Mixture
Begin by blending the base ingredients for your ice cream.
Combine the coconut cream, coconut milk, pistachio cream, vanilla extract, and coconut sugar in a blender.
Blend until smooth and creamy.
Pour this mixture into ice cream bar molds. Freeze for about 2 hours or until mostly set.
Step 2: Prepare the Kataifi
While your bars freeze, prepare the kataifi topping.
Heat a skillet over medium heat and add 2 tsp of oil.
Toast the kataifi, stirring constantly until golden brown and crispy. This should take about 5–7 minutes.
Remove from heat and mix in 1/4 cup of pistachio cream. Set aside.
Step 3: Assemble the Bars
Once your ice cream bars have partially set, it’s time to assemble them.
Carefully remove them from their molds after about 2 hours.
Spoon some of your prepared pistachio kataifi mixture into each bar’s center. Smooth it out evenly.
Return them to the freezer for another 20 minutes to firm up.
Step 4: Dip in Chocolate
Get ready to coat your bars with chocolate!
In a microwave-safe bowl, melt together the chocolate and coconut oil. Heat in 30-second increments until smooth, stirring between each increment.
Dip each frozen bar into the melted chocolate until fully coated. Place on parchment paper.
Step 5: Final Touches
Add some finishing touches before serving or storing your bars.
Drizzle any remaining melted chocolate over each bar for an extra touch of sweetness.
Sprinkle with chopped pistachios. Return to the freezer one last time until fully set. Enjoy immediately or store in the freezer for later!

Common Mistakes to Avoid
When making Dubai Chocolate Ice Cream Bars, avoiding common pitfalls can lead to a more successful treat. Here are some mistakes to watch out for:
- Using the wrong coconut cream – Make sure to use only the solid parts of coconut cream for the right texture. Check your can and choose wisely!
- Overmixing the ingredients – Blend just until smooth; overmixing can create an unwanted texture in the ice cream bars. Keep it simple for the best results.
- Not freezing long enough – Allow sufficient time for the bars to freeze completely. If they are not firm, they will not hold their shape when dipped in chocolate.
- Skipping the kataifi toasting – Toasting kataifi adds a crispy texture that enhances flavor. Don’t skip this step for a delightful crunch!
- Dipping in too hot chocolate – Ensure your melted chocolate is warm but not too hot, as it can melt the ice cream bars. Aim for a smooth, gentle dip.
- Neglecting garnishes – Don’t forget to sprinkle crushed pistachios on top! They add both flavor and visual appeal to your dessert.

Can I customize my Dubai Chocolate Ice Cream Bars?
Absolutely! You can add different flavors or mix-ins like berries or nuts to suit your taste.
How do I achieve a creamy texture?
Use full-fat coconut cream and blend until smooth. This ensures a rich and creamy consistency.
Are Dubai Chocolate Ice Cream Bars vegan-friendly?
Yes! All ingredients used in this recipe are plant-based, making them suitable for vegans.
What can I substitute for pistachio cream?
Almond or cashew cream works well as alternatives if you’re looking for variety or don’t have pistachio cream on hand.
